Abstract: The rapid emergence of published data regarding drug enantiomers should be reflected in the use of racemic drugs in the clinical setting. The Department of Pharmacy, University of Malta, becoming aware of the problems created by the unknowledgeable use of racemic drugs has conducted two studies. The first study data focused on quantifying the number of chiral drugs in the Maltese National Formulary, being administered as racemic mixtures, in order to provide a better basis for purchase specifications when procuring drugs. The second study analyzed attitudes by physicians towards drug chirality.
